Lokelani 'Ohana creates socially therapeutic programs within our community with elements of native Hawaiian culture and tradition for adults with developmental disabilities. One of the programs we run is in biodynamic gardening. Our farm is located on old Hawaiian land on the North shore of Maui, Hawaii. The land presents a combination of established and newer fruit trees with terraces of taro, potatoes and many varieties of vegetables and herbs. We presently sell our produce to the local health food stores. The farm also grows cotton and other products for a second program we offer the community in Saori Weaving. We work with people from Mediaid Waiver Programs and enjoy working with wwoofers for the last three years from around the world. We are a vibrant sustainable ohana where adults with developmental disabilities live, learn, and work together with reverence for spirit, creativity and nature supporting each other's potential and sharing a life of purpose.
